This ensures that reauthentication of the connection takes place. Everything you need to get started with this php course is set out in. Using the entitymanager to insert, update, delete and find objects in the database. This is a complete and free php programming course for beginners. This section helps you get started with mysql quickly if you have never worked with mysql before. Learn php and mysql and start developing web apps like a pro. Php supports a large number of major protocols such as pop3, imap, and ldap. In this demo, we will see how create database and table in mysql using php admin tool from wamp server.
Mysql tutorial how to install mysql 8 on windows, mac os. Getting started with php download free php tutorial in pdf,training document under 10 pages for beginners. Mar 16, 2014 unsubscribe from programmingknowledge. For example, apache doesnt serve up just html files it handles a wide range of files, from images and. To help you get up to speed quickly in this regard, this chapter will. Mysql is an opensource relational database management system rdbms that is developed and supported by oracle corporation mysql is supported on a large number of platforms, including linux variants, os x, and windows. Pdf getting started with php computer tutorials in pdf. Mysql is the worlds most popular opensource database. Abstract mysql is the worlds most popular opensource database.
Text content is released under creative commons bysa. Web development tutorial getting started with mysql and. When you want to work on php code you need to start apachemysql on the. The mysql server, once started, executes even very complex queries with huge result sets in recordsetting time.
Examples for most of the supported database systems are provided in this file. Getting started with phpmysql programming 5 comments in this tutorial, i will show you how to quickly prepare a login screen to your phpmysql webapplication. This course also comes with a certificate of completion. It is a serverside scripting language that sends information directly to the server when a user submits a form. Web pages, i ll begin with an introduction to databases in general, and the mysql relational. If you are using mysql workbench commercial editions, see the mysql workbench commercial license information user manual for licensing information, including licensing information relating to thirdparty software that may be included in this commercial edition release. Getting started with sql as you already know sql is used to communicate with the database, so before you start experimenting with sql, you need access to a database system first. This guide covers getting started with the doctrine orm. For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ql users. You can test or execute most of the sql statements provided as examples throughout the tutorials, using our online sql editor. Its assumed that you already have some html skills.
This course is adapted to your level as well as all php pdf courses to better enrich your knowledge. I looked up good ides for this i previously used netbeans and eclipse was recommended. The objectoriented interface shows functions grouped by their purpose, making it easier to get started. I can display the data in the table, and generate the pdf off my template, but as soon as i add the php mysql database field variables i keep getting errors about he variables and the pdf gereator fails. Getting started with php in eclipse ide stack overflow. The menu looks like, then go to database section and create a database name tutorialsavvy. Give a quick introduction to databases and mysql as a relational database management system rdbms show you step by step how to install mysql server on your computer for practicing with the tutorials. In this chapter, well learn how to work with mysql. Drawing content from a database allows you to present material in ways that would be impracticalif not impossiblewith a static website. For a walkthrough of setting up a dynamic website on linux, see getting started with aws computing basics for linux, which describes setting up a dynamic website that uses apache, php and mysql.
I swear this experience will boost your enthusiasm towards programming. Start the ide, switch to the projects window, and choose file new project. The php hypertext preprocessor php is a programming language that allows web developers to create dynamic content. The database configuration for your application is located at configdatabase. Getting started with libmysqld free download as powerpoint presentation. How to download and install php and mysql tools and frameworks onto a server and home machine. Mysql native driver has supported ssl since php version 5. For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ql.
You also get the option to include the mysql bin files in the windows path. Assuming you have not already created a connection, you can use the default values here, although if your mysql server has a password set for root, you can set it here by clicking on store in vault. I am a java programmer, but recently got a job working with php and mysql. By default, laravels sample environment configuration is. Go to file save as to save the file to the site and name it details. After that, you will learn how you can combine php and mysql to start creating your own dynamic web. This brief tutorial helps you get started using the database engine. As a result of subclassing it is possible to refine only selected methods and. Install wampserver or xampp on your pc to quickly create web applications with apache, php and a mysql database.
Below are some instructions to help you get mysql up and running in a few easy steps. May 10, 20 in this demo, we will see how create database and table in mysql using php admin tool from wamp server. From the very start, the php language was created with practicality in mind. A project contains the information on the location of the project files and the way you want to run and debug your application run configuration. Free mysql tutorial beginner php and mysql tutorial udemy. As a result of subclassing it is possible to refine only selected methods and you can choose to have pre or post hooks. Mysql is supported on a large number of platforms, including linux variants, os x, and windows. If you need a refresher on html, then click the link for the web design course on the left of this page. I know that mysql is primarily text based, but i also know that there are other programs that can work on top of it as a gui. Define the connection name value, such as myfirstconnection as the next figure shows. Heres the table of content for this tutorial series. The mysql notes for professionals book is compiled from stack overflow documentation, the content is written by the beautiful people at stack overflow. Abstract this manual describes the php extensions and interfaces that can be used with mysql.
Take advantage of this course called getting started with php to improve your web development skills and better understand php. This manual describes the php extensions and interfaces that can be used with mysql. Setting up project with php and mysql database tutorial. By installing mysql as a service by default the server will be started automatically and will restart in even of failure. Mysql deeply embedded version, libmysqld, is coming back in mysql version 5. Programming with mysql and php this book was written from a set of courses i teach in a further education college. Create and manipulate adobe flash and portable document format pdf files. Let me tell you what im trying to do and hopefully mysql in conjunction with some other stuff can get it done. Learning php, mysql, javascript, and css fsu college of. In this file you may define all of your database connections, as well as specify which connection should be used by default. Although im sure youll be anxious to get started building dynamic. We start with a simple web page which should be a standard xhtml document but can actually be just a blank page without any html. Despite its powerful features, mysql is simple to set up and easy to use. Before begin, be sure to have a code editor and some working knowledge of html and css.
All you need to do is download the training document, open it. Mysql just getting started and i want to know if mysql is. See credits at the end of this book whom contributed to the various chapters. It is entirely compatible with mysql for most applications. All you need to do is download the training document, open it and start learning php for free. Getting started with iot using raspberry pi and php phppot.
It is a simple, lightweight apache distribution that makes it extremely easy for developers to create a local web server for testing purposes. Here, you will learn how easy it is to create dynamic web pages using php. Installation, we installed and set up two software programs. Getting started and deploying with git by now, im sure youve heard of sitepoint s and windows azures push the web forward contest. Net, perl, php, python, and ruby mariadb is a fork of mysql with a slightly different. I cannot get the php variables to work in the pdf generator. Dynamic websites require serverside technologies such as php, java, or. Getting started with mysql ligaya turmelle principal technical support engineer, mysql tuesday, february 26, 20. Mysql is often deployed in a lamp linuxapache mysql php, wamp windowsapache mysql php, or mamp macosapache mysql php environment. If you found any issue while installing, you can explicitly specify the module version as follows. Everything you need to set up a web server server application apache, database mysql, and scripting language.
Php is pleasingly zippy in its execution, especially when compiled as an apache module on the unix side. Php users must be able to call the parent implementation of an overwritten method. I heard of one called php myadmin or something like that. Mariadb is a fork of mysql with a slightly different feature set. Welcome to the getting started with the database engine tutorial.
Xampp stands for crossplatform x, apache a, mysql m, php p and perl p. Basically, php is used to develop web applications. The mysql server, once started, executes even very complex queries with huge. In this tutorial, i have given an introduction to iot, raspberry pi essentials, a hello world and a basic led on off with simple code examples. This tutorial is intended for users who are new to sql server and who have installed sql server or sql server express. There are some prerequisites for the tutorial that have to be installed. Frequently used operations managing databases, tables, columns, relations, indexes, users, permissions, etc can be performed via the user interface, while you.
Dynamic websites take on a whole new meaning in combination with a database. The pip command allows you to install mysql python connector on any operating system including windows, macos, linux, and unix. This guide is designed for beginners that havent worked with doctrine orm before. The engine has been largely rewritten, and php is now even quicker than older versions.
This tutorial shows you how to connect to the database engine using sql. All components in lamp is free and opensource, inclusive of the operating system. How to configure relevant setting to match the needs of your project. It contains of a number of code samples and examples which you can download from this site. We also explain how to perform some basic operations with mysql using the mysql client. To start php development in the netbeans ide for php, you first need to create a project. Getting started tutorial specify host machine next you will set up a connection, or select an existing connection to use to connect to the server.